Naples is a beautiful town located in southern Maine. It is home to many kid friendly activities, including a variety of parks and playgrounds, a public beach, many hiking and biking trails, and a variety of shops and restaurants. There is also a public library, a museum, and a number of public events held throughout the year. Naples is a great place to raise a family or just to visit for a fun weekend getaway.
